## Releases

The Hollowgate metrics-aggregation sidecar ships on its own cadence, decoupled from the main service. Reviewers: verify the sidecar version pin in the deploy manifest matches the changelog entry. Scrape intervals under 10s are rejected in CI. Every sidecar image is signed at build, and the signing key follows below.

release key, fajef-kajeg: bky19_LdLu6Ne6FLi8he2c24d

Subject: Validator plugin system — review requested

The Corvane validator framework now loads third-party plugins at startup. Security notes: plugins run in a capability-restricted sandbox, no network egress, no filesystem writes outside scratch. Manifests are signature-checked against the Ashwell registry before load; unsigned plugins are rejected, not warned. Please review the sandbox escape tests and the manifest parser in particular. The candidate build carries the token listed below.

pipeline stamp: htk21_0e1a1ddcdb5bfd88d6dd6

Subject: Sproutly scheduler — release 2.4

Welcome aboard. This release moves watering schedules to the new zone-based model; old per-plant timers migrate automatically on first boot. Please smoke-test the greenhouse simulator before Friday. Config lives in sched.toml — don't edit the legacy cron file, it's ignored now. Verify you're running the build identified below.

build token for tawip-yageg: htk9_92ac43d42

// As discussed in last week's sync: every validator must register
// through this constant rather than patching the dispatch table
// directly. The Fennick incident happened because two plugins
// claimed the same type key and silently overwrote each other.
// Registration order is now deterministic (sorted by plugin name),
// so snapshot diffs in the Harlow suite should be stable again.
// Please review new entries at the sync before merging.
// The registry build is pinned to the trace token below.

build token for kagaf-hahof: htk14_9d3d4d26d7d8de